1.54 Research Engineer – Humanoid Manipulation (Mountain View/Boston)

Field AI is transforming how robots interact with the real world, focusing on building reliable AI systems for complex challenges in robotics. The Research Engineer will work on humanoid manipulation, collaborating with engineers and scientists to develop and refine robotic systems that enhance autonomous control and loco-manipulation capabilities.

Responsibilities

Advance Humanoid Manipulation Research & Development
Drive humanoid manipulation projects from ideation to deployment
Design, prototype, and evaluate manipulation strategies across diverse tasks
Build Systems that Bridge Research & Deployment
Translate research insights into working robotic systems for real-world use
Ensure systems are robust, reproducible, and aligned with data-collection needs
Drive Robotics Foundation Model Development
Contribute to large-scale data collection and learning pipelines powering foundation models
Ensure model development remains embodiment agnostic, enabling transfer across diverse robotic platforms
Collaborate with research scientists to integrate manipulation data into scalable robot learning systems
Collaborate Across Disciplines
Partner with mechanical/electrical engineers on robot hardware integration
Work with teleoperators to refine interfaces and improve manipulation outcomes
Act as a bridge between autonomy research and applied robotics
Rapidly Iterate & Deliver
Prototype quickly and run experiments in the field
Balance research exploration with fast, tangible progress for immediate goals

Qualification

Robotics manipulationRobot kinematicsC++PythonRobotics middlewareLearning-based manipulationPassion for roboticsProblem-solving mindsetCollaborative teamwork

Required

Bachelor's, Master's, or PhD in Robotics, Computer Science, Mechanical Engineering, or related field
2+ years of hands-on experience in robotics manipulation (academic or industry)
Expertise in robot kinematics, dynamics, and control, particularly for manipulation
Strong problem-solving mindset, able to thrive in fast-moving, collaborative teams
Strong software development skills in C++ and/or Python, with experience in robotics middleware (ROS, ROS 2, or similar)
Track record of implementing and evaluating robotic systems in real-world environments
Passion for tackling challenging problems and the courage to challenge the status quo

Preferred

Experience with humanoid robots or multi-fingered robotic hands
Prior work in learning-based manipulation (imitation learning, reinforcement learning, etc.)
Familiarity with teleoperation systems and human-robot interaction
Publications or open-source contributions in robotics conferences/journals
Experience with large-scale data collection and dataset management
Passion for bridging research frontiers with practical, field-ready robotics
